The idiopathic normal-pressure hydrocephalus Radscale: a radiological scale for structured evaluation.

A new radiological scale, the iNPH Radscale, was developed to assess idiopathic normal-pressure hydrocephalus (iNPH) using brain imaging. This scale shows a significant correlation with clinical symptoms, aiding in iNPH diagnosis.
Area of Science:
- Neurology
- Radiology
- Medical Imaging
Background:
- Idiopathic normal-pressure hydrocephalus (iNPH) diagnosis relies on imaging, but a structured assessment of radiological signs is lacking.
- Current diagnostic methods for iNPH require a comprehensive radiological evaluation tool.
Purpose of the Study:
- To construct a radiological scale (iNPH Radscale) based on morphological signs of iNPH.
- To compare the developed radiological scale with existing clinical symptoms of iNPH.
Main Methods:
- A prospective, population-based study included 168 individuals who underwent brain CT and neurological examination.
- Two radiologists independently evaluated eight radiological parameters, including Evans' index and ventricular size.
- Clinical symptoms were assessed using Hellström's iNPH scale.
Main Results:
- Seven radiological parameters, excluding ventricular roof bulging, were significantly associated with clinical iNPH symptoms.
- The iNPH Radscale score (0-12) demonstrated a significant correlation (r=0.55, P<0.001) with clinical symptoms.
- High inter-rater agreement (ICC 0.74-0.97) was observed for the evaluated radiological parameters.
Conclusions:
- The iNPH Radscale offers a structured approach for radiological assessment in iNPH diagnosis.
- A high iNPH Radscale score combined with clinical symptoms should prompt further evaluation for potential shunt surgery.
